Absolutely Phantomless - April 13, 2005 - Australia
The Australian cast of Phantom of the Opera in their annual Easter Charity Concert. Each of Cameron Mackintosh's Australian shows participates at midnight after their regular performances. These shows feature the cast members parodying songs and other shows, with a slight tilt towards their own productions. Pro-shot for video, these tapes were made for cast and crew only. Very rare!
